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at, Aspur Deosara

Bhanaipur is a Gram Panchayat located in the Pratapgarh district of Uttar Pradesh. It falls under the Aspur Deosara Kshettra Panchayat and Pratapgarh Zila Panchayat.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at covers a single village, Bhanaipur. It is headed by an elected Gram Pradhan, while administrative work is handled by the Gram Panchayat Adhikari.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at

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at is part of Uttar Pradesh's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Aspur Deosara Kshettra Panchayat is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Pratapgarh Zila Panchayat is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Bhanaipur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
